Minneapolis, Minnesota vs Soure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Minneapolis, Minnesota, Usa and Soure, Brazil is approximately 6,708 km or 4,168 mi.
  • To reach Minneapolis, Minnesota in this distance one would set out from Soure bearing 325°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Minneapolis, Minnesota bearing 306° or NW .
  • Minneapolis, Minnesota has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Soure has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• Minneapolis, Minnesota is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Soure is in or near the trop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 20.2 °C (36.4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 32.1 °C (57.8°F) more in Minneapolis, Minnesota.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 2496.5 mm (98.3 in) less which is equivalent to 2496.5 l/m² (61.27 US gal/ft²) or 24,965,000 l/ha (2,668,924 US gal/ac) less. About 2/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 29.5° lower in Minneapolis, Minnesota than in Soure.
  • Relative humidity levels are 22.6%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 24.3°C (43.7°F) lower.
